As one of the backbones of the team, he played a key role in the team's achievements that year as they went on to win Stage 1 and place fourth at Masters Shanghai. Their year later ended one step away from Champions after falling at the final hurdle to KRÜ Esports.

In 2025, the thieves had middling results, consistently making domestic playoffs appearances but finding themselves unable to qualify to international VCT events with top-six finishes in both Stage 1 and Stage 2.

In the offseason, 100 Thieves allowed almost every member on the team to explore their options, indicating the possibility of a major rebuild after they had historically maintained a stable core in the partnerships era. eeiu's official departure from the team follows those of Anthony "Zikz" Gray, Drew "Kess" Lee, and Kelden "Boostio" Pupello earlier this month. With the rest of the team allowed to explore options, the team currently does not have any official active members.
